Date(s) Skied: 4/25-26

Resort or Ski Area: killington

Conditions: saturday sunny hi near 80. sunday clouds, fog hi 60.

Trip Report: bumps returned to k this weekend with minimal grooming. thought saturday was one of great days of the season. sunburn & bikini alert high. started out at 8:30 down a groomed east fall just to get our legs. that was it for groomers. spent most of the day running the canyon quad. best bumps on escapade, upper catwalk, dipper woods, skiers left lower cascade and upper downdraft. later switched operations to the supe quad. skye hawk was monstrous. middle ovation had nice bumps a little spaced. same with lower skye lark. lower supe had great lines both skiers right & left. they had groomed the middle. finished off on ol, which as it's been since it closed was the rotd.

sunday was a different story. got there a little later to find the mtn t-t-b in clouds & fog. temps in upper 50's so we figured the mtn would still ski fine. wrong ... did a couple shots in the canyon and things were very set up down to the ice base in spots. complicated by lack of vis, skiing was rough. took a break on the deck with ty. fog lifted in the supe area so we did a few runs there. things were starting to soften particularly the lower supe skiers right line giving us hope for the afternoon. after lunch did a bunch of downdrafts & escapade/cascade before heading over to bear. different world. sunshine and 10 degrees warmer. lingered for quite a while taking it all in. ol absolutely gorgeous corn. course was perfection. savored every turn. finished off on supe running skye hawk>supe which skied great.

canyon looks to be done. with the weather this week doubt that other than east fall, nothing will survive. runout will be toast. wouldn't be surprised if it was only supe for closing weekend.

doubt i'll be up for the close next saturday so this could be it for me. what an awesome way to end a great season.
